  • Local Nurseries: Visiting a local nursery is a great way to see and choose from a wide variety of bonsai trees. Experts at the nursery can provide guidance on caring for your bonsai and answer any questions you may have.
  • Garden Centers: Many garden centers carry bonsai trees as part of their inventory. These centers often have a selection of bonsai trees suitable for beginners as well as more advanced enthusiasts.
  • Online Stores: Buying bonsai trees online offers convenience and access to a large selection of options. Make sure to choose a reputable online store that specializes in bonsai trees and provides detailed information about each tree’s care requirements.
  • Bonsai Specialty Stores: Some cities have stores exclusively dedicated to bonsai trees and supplies. These specialty stores often have a wide variety of bonsai trees to choose from and knowledgeable staff who can assist you in selecting the right tree.
  • Bonsai Shows and Exhibitions: Attending bonsai shows and exhibitions is another way to find and purchase bonsai trees. These events often feature vendors who sell bonsai trees of various sizes and styles.

When looking to purchase a bonsai tree at Asda, there are several important factors to consider to ensure that you choose the right tree for your needs:

  1. Size: Consider the size of the bonsai tree you want to purchase. Asda may offer a variety of sizes ranging from small to medium or even large. Determine the appropriate size based on your available space and the look you want to achieve.
  2. Species: Bonsai trees come in various species, each with its own characteristics and care requirements. Choose a species that suits your climate, as well as your level of experience with bonsai care.
  3. Quality: Examine the overall quality of the bonsai tree before making a purchase. Look for healthy leaves, well-structured branches, and a well-maintained appearance. Avoid trees with signs of pests, disease, or damage.
  4. Price: Compare prices of bonsai trees at Asda to ensure you are getting a fair deal. Take into account the size, species, and quality of the tree when deciding on its value.
  5. Care Instructions: Check if Asda provides any care instructions or guidance for the bonsai trees they sell. Understanding the specific care requirements of your chosen tree is crucial for its long-term health and growth.

1. Garden Centres: Local garden centres often have a wide selection of bonsai trees. They usually have knowledgeable staff who can provide advice on care and maintenance.

2. Online Retailers: There are many online retailers that specialize in selling bonsai trees. Websites like Amazon and eBay have a variety of options to choose from. Just be sure to read customer reviews and check the seller’s reputation before making a purchase.

3. Bonsai Nurseries: Bonsai nurseries are dedicated to growing and selling bonsai trees. They often have a larger selection compared to other stores and can provide guidance on choosing the right tree for your needs.

4. Bonsai Clubs and Societies: Joining a local bonsai club or society can be a great way to connect with fellow bonsai enthusiasts. Members often sell or trade bonsai trees amongst each other, allowing you to expand your collection and learn from experienced growers.
